What You’ll Do
As a QIDP, you will play a key leadership role in helping individuals live as independently and successfully as possible in the community.
- Oversee and monitor individualized service plans
- Support and guide Direct Support Professionals (DSPs)
- Ensure quality care and compliance with DHS/DDD standards
- Advocate for residents and help them achieve personal goals
- Coordinate services and maintain documentation
- Build strong relationships with individuals, families, and team members

Qualifications
- Bachelor’s Degree in a Human Service-related field (required)
- Minimum 1 year experience working with individuals with developmental disabilities
- QIDP certification preferred (but we will train the right candidate)
- Strong leadership, communication, and organizational skills
